I dont get enough practice in actual speaking. Have you all handed in your exercise books?

Collect all the exercise books after class, and take them to my office, please. Here are your exercise books. Please give them out.

I m sorry, I have left your exercise books in the office. Monitor , would you please go and get them? They are on my desk.

I have used up all the chalk. Please get some more from the office. There goes the bell.

Please get everything ready for class. You must learn to take notes. Dont whisper to one another. Is everyone(everybody) here?

He wrote to the office to ask for leave.

He is absent because he has something urgent to attend to at home. He is absent because he is not feeling well. Please answer when your name is called.

I overslept because I stayed up too late last night. Today lets go on(continue)from where we left off.

We are going to take up a new lesson today.We shall first read and discuss the new vocabulary .Then we shall read the text .

Today, we shall have a general review of what we have learned so far. Look at the position of my lips when I pronounce this vowel sound. I shall read the material three times.After that , you will retell the story. We shall take the vocabulary list first. Youve mispronounced this word. Dont fidget.

May I be excused from the class? I m not feeling well.

When we read any text, we should pay attention to sentence stress, word relationships and elision .

Pay attention to the others when they are read.Take note of their mistakes, and avoid them.

You must be more attentive next time.

He used a rising tone instead of a falling tone.

You need to pay special attention to the flow. Dont run words together. You should not blur or mubble the sound.

We should read aloud accurately, clearly, and with expressionall the while observing the rules of intonation.

I‟ll read the test through(once), and then explain the difficult point (parts).

Ill read the whole passage over first ,and then ,go through it slowly, sentence by sentence .

This paragraph contains a very good portrayal. I hope you will learn it by heart. Dont hesitate to ask me if anything is not clear to you . Say it again, please. I didnt quite catch the last part. Im awfully sorry, but I didnt understand that sentence. You read much better now than before. Keep it up.

Please come to me if you dont(quite) understand. Ill be in the office after class. Write down your questions, and give them to me beforehand. Im going to ask you questions on the text.

Now, I shall ask you a few questions to see how well you know the lesson. Use the third person when you answer this question, please. Who will volunteer to answer this question?

Please listen carefully to see his answer is correct.

When you answer a question, you must keep to the point. Speak plainly, please. Well done.

Can you analyse the sentence They always help each other?

Dont use the same words, the same structure or the same patterns too often in your retelling.

You didnt do very well this time. Try to do better next time.

Please change the text into the third person, and make other necessary changes. Your English is not colloquial enough.

Each person must come up with five questions on the picture. Do you know whats wrong with this sentence?

Yes, youre right. He didnt translate the third sentence correctly. His translation is not faithful enough to the original. Your tenses are slipping. Watch out for your tenses. Who can give a better translation of this sentence?

Im sure other students have a lot to say, but time is about up. We have to stop here. Can you give the comparative and superlative degrees(forms) of this adjective? Please give a synonym and antonym for this word. Can you identify the part of speech of this word?
